Stock Price

The cost of purchasing a share of a company, which fluctuates based on demand and supply in the market.

Constant Annual Dividend

A dividend payment that a company commits to distribute to its shareholders at a steady rate each year.

Rate of Return

An indicator of the financial success or failure of an investment, calculated by dividing the profit (or loss) by the investment’s initial cost.

Dividend Amount

The total sum of money paid to shareholders, typically expressed on a per-share basis, from a corporation's earnings.
